Thanks! I did tell my dad thank you from you~ The shower does work, but I don't think it was working when we bought the house. It's actually not in the same location as it was in the movie. We decided to build a guest house since a lot of family tends to visit us in the summer, but we wanted to keep the shower. So...we just moved it a little closer to the dock! The dock also was rebuilt and is closer to the house than it was in the movie, but we didn't build that. I think the past owners did.

The stores in the movie were not made just for the movie. They were actual stores. However, a bridge was built connecting Franklin County (where the house is) and Bedford County (the county next to it.) This provided a faster way for people to travel between the two counties than the road that the stores are on, and the road where the stores are was was blocked off at the end and left to decay. It's really sad to see how far gone that general store and the surrounding buildings are. It really looks like nobody has touched them since the movie was filmed over 20 years ago. In the movie, it looked like they really were in the bustling downtown area of a resort town...but in reality, it's just a couple of buildings out in the middle of nowhere. As for the house, they actually filmed the real interior of the house, rather than using a set like they often do for interior shots. There are pictures of the inside of the house up on the internet, and it doesn't look all that different from how it looked in the movie.
